Shizzee, I'm a knicks fan. You are failing to analyze one major point (long term value) and also you are ENTIRELY undervaluing George.

Do I agree that Melo has significant value for the next few years? Yes.

But I also realize you are talking about a vet that is a decent amount older, with a lot more tread on his tires. George is going to be great for this contract AND another contract. George is the best long term potential of all 3. Immediate potential, again, it is arguable. But I would actually consider George the best, then griffin and melo to be in the same boat.

As far as George never being the go to guy that Melo is? That is just wrong.

George is entirely capable of being the go to guy and leading a team to the playoffs. HE is doing it right now. Additionally, he is 25, he didn't playlast year basically, aka less wear and tear. He is for the most part a healthy healthy player. He is selfless and constantly getting better. He can guard 3 positions and his defense is elite.

If the knicks could get him, I'd do it in a heart beat. But its not reasonable. Its not reasonable that the clippers would (if they got him for griffin, whcih they wouldnt) would then trade george for Melo.

At this point, it is possible for the knicks to get griffin for melo. At least not out of the rhelm of possibility. And that wouldn't be bad at all. But this trade is just nonsense. You can disagree all you want, but as a Knicks fan, I can at least reasonably assess the players values. which apparently you fail at.
